ABSTRACT:
A cigarette case comprises a rectangular frame body, a front cover and an upper cover. The three elements are slidably secured to one another to form a tight enclosure. The frame body includes a front portion, a rear portion and a hollow central portion. The frame body has an elongated slot at a side wall and has a spring-loaded transporting means set in its lower end. A drier storage box with a number of through holes on a front surface thereof is received in the rear portion for absorbing moisture inside the frame body. The front cover includes a side hole on its lower portion for ejecting cigarettes. A switch button of an actuating and lighting means is slidable to uncover the side hole and simultaneously light up a bulb for indicating that the side hole is uncovered.
